== Latin == === Alternative forms === fēnebris === Etymology === For *faenesris, from faenus. === Pronunciation === (Classical Latin) IPA(key): [ˈfae̯.nɛ.brɪs] (modern Italianate Ecclesiastical) IPA(key): [ˈfɛː.ne.bris] (Classical Latin) IPA(key): [fae̯ˈnɛb.rɪs] (modern Italianate Ecclesiastical) IPA(key): [feˈnɛb.ris] === Adjective === faenebris (neuter faenebre); third-declension two-termination adjective of or related to interest or usury ==== Declension ==== Third-declension two-termination adjective. === References === “faenebris”, in Charlton T. Lewis and Charles Short (1879), A Latin Dictionary, Oxford: Clarendon Press “faenebris”, in Gaffiot, Félix (1934), Dictionnaire illustré latin-français, Hachette.
